Based on Ontario Well being, the Ontario common for wait occasions for an MRI relies on severity, with priority-4 sufferers ready 88 days, priority-3 sufferers ready 28 days and priority-2 sufferers ready three days.

Based on the province, sufferers inside the priority-1 group are scanned instantly, and should not included in wait-time information.

The province units goal occasions primarily based on data from surgeons, specialists, and well being care directors, primarily based on scientific proof. Thirty-four per cent of Ontario sufferers have been scanned inside their group’s goal time.

In Simcoe County there are two choices for an MRI: RVH in Barrie has two scanners, whereas Orillia Troopers’ Memorial Hospital (OSMH) has one.

Based on information supplied by RVH, in 2023, the typical await an MRI at RVH was 103 days, whereas at OSMH, it was 49 days.

RVH performefd 22,000 MRIs in 2023, whereas OSMH carried out 9,000.

The provincial authorities introduced in late 2022 that they have been approving working funding for a brand new MRI lab at Collingwood Common and Marine Hospital, and the hospital’s basis managed to fundraise $5 million to pay for the machine and renovations as of December 2023.

Based on most up-to-date estimates from CEO and president of CGMH Mike Lacroix, they anticipate to have the brand new machine operational within the first quarter of 2025.

Even when Elaine have been in a position to get in to get an MRI and got a referral for her surgical procedure, the wait occasions for surgical procedure are additionally daunting.

Based on provincial information, the wait time from getting a referral to seeing a primary clinician for a spinal surgical procedure is 126 days for priority-4 sufferers, 90 days for priority-3 sufferers and 47 days for priority-2 sufferers. Inside this wait class, 73 per cent of sufferers are handled inside the goal time.

The time from choice to precise spinal surgical procedure is 164 days for priority-4 sufferers, 82 days for priority-3 sufferers and 85 days for priority-2 sufferers. Inside this wait class, 67 per cent of sufferers are handled inside the goal time.
